MrsP.com Launches Free Children’s Reader Challenge Game
Game uses funny quizzes to help kids become better readers
Portland, OR August 18, 2010 --- www.MrsP.com releases a new free Reader Challenge game today just in time for the back to school season. It features some of Mrs. P’s favorite classic stories from her FREE Magic Library as well as the winning entries from last year’s “Be a Famous Writer” contest. The game helps children with their comprehension and reading-retention skills by asking them questions about what they’ve just read. Mrs. P makes guest appearances in the game, helping kids find the right answers with funny audio and visual messages.

The game will also be useful helping kids maintain their reading skills over the summer, Kinney said, avoiding the setbacks that so often occur during months away from school.
Beginning readers who aren’t ready to play the Reading Challenge game alone can take advantage of the read-along options at Mrs. P’s website, and have Mrs. P read the stories to them before they take the quiz.
